Abstract
In this article an experimental analysis of the capacitive and inductive effects in a printed circuit board using a two pole RC filter widely known, with several wide and length size traces is presented. The ideal frequency transfer response graphs and graphics that include inductive and capacitive effects due to the size of signal paths in a microstrip printed circuit board are presented. The frequency response plot obtained experimentally and the plots obtained simulating the electric equivalent circuit proposed using the SPICE, SERENADE and MATLAB programs are also shown. The error obtained was less than the 2%
